The Evolution of Afrobeat: Dancehall & Reggae Influences
Afrobeat's signature sound, while firmly rooted in West African musical traditions , has undergone a remarkable evolution, heavily shaped by the influence of Caribbean genres like Dancehall and Reggae. At first , the rhythmic intricacy of Afrobeat, pioneered by Fela Kuti, established its core identity, but the subsequent decades saw artists integrating elements of Jamaican music. Dancehall’s pulsating rhythms and catchy lyrical styles found a natural fit with Afrobeat's message-driven lyrics and polyrhythmic textures. Reggae's relaxed feel, with its emphasis on sung delivery and positive themes, also provided a rich source of creativity . This combination is evident in the use of offbeat rhythms, call-and-response , and the occasional adoption of Dancehall/Reggae musical techniques. The result is a vibrant, evolving Afrobeat landscape that honors its origins while embracing a global musical dialogue .
